Our biennial Consultation on Conscience brings social justice issues to the forefront of our awareness and empowers our community to action. We have invited those who are involved in doing the most important work of social justice today to educate us and teach us how to become more involved.
New this year, we are hosting the first-ever New Jersey state-wide Consultation on Conscience, in cooperation with the Religious Action Center of Reform Judaism (the RAC). The RAC mobilizes around federal, state, and local legislation and organizes communities to created a world overflowing with justice compassion, and peace.
